Solution for 3b^2+36b+90=0 equation:


Simplifying
3b2 + 36b + 90 = 0

Reorder the terms:
90 + 36b + 3b2 = 0

Solving
90 + 36b + 3b2 = 0

Solving for variable 'b'.

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'3'.
3(30 + 12b + b2) = 0

Ignore the factor 3.

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(30 + 12b + b2)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 30 + 12b + b2 = 0 Solving 30 + 12b + b2 = 0 Begin completing the square. Move the constant term to the right: Add '-30' to each side of the equation. 30 + 12b + -30 + b2 = 0 + -30 Reorder the terms: 30 + -30 + 12b + b2 = 0 + -30 Combine like terms: 30 + -30 = 0 0 + 12b + b2 = 0 + -30 12b + b2 = 0 + -30 Combine like terms: 0 + -30 = -30 12b + b2 = -30 The b term is 12b. Take half its coefficient (6). Square it (36) and add it to both sides. Add '36' to each side of the equation. 12b + 36 + b2 = -30 + 36 Reorder the terms: 36 + 12b + b2 = -30 + 36 Combine like terms: -30 + 36 = 6 36 + 12b + b2 = 6 Factor a perfect square on the left side: (b + 6)(b + 6) = 6 Calculate the square root of the right side: 2.449489743 Break this problem into two subproblems by setting (b + 6) equal to 2.449489743 and -2.449489743.

Subproblem 1

b + 6 = 2.449489743 Simplifying b + 6 = 2.449489743 Reorder the terms: 6 + b = 2.449489743 Solving 6 + b = 2.449489743 Solving for variable 'b'.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-6' to each side of the equation. 6 + -6 + b = 2.449489743 + -6 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0 0 + b = 2.449489743 + -6 b = 2.449489743 + -6 Combine like terms: 2.449489743 + -6 = -3.550510257 b = -3.550510257 Simplifying b = -3.550510257

Subproblem 2

b + 6 = -2.449489743 Simplifying b + 6 = -2.449489743 Reorder the terms: 6 + b = -2.449489743 Solving 6 + b = -2.449489743 Solving for variable 'b'.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-6' to each side of the equation. 6 + -6 + b = -2.449489743 + -6 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0 0 + b = -2.449489743 + -6 b = -2.449489743 + -6 Combine like terms: -2.449489743 + -6 = -8.449489743 b = -8.449489743 Simplifying b = -8.449489743

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. b = {-3.550510257, -8.449489743}

Solution

b = {-3.550510257, -8.449489743}
